Past and hypothetical performance
Past performance is not indicative of future results. Backtests, walk-forward studies, paper trading, and other hypothetical results do not represent actual trading and can differ materially from live outcomes. Hypothetical work benefits from hindsight and cannot fully reproduce the financial and psychological effects of risking capital.
A favorable result may depend on a particular period, market regime, universe, cost model, parameter choice, or data revision. No metric or validation procedure proves that a strategy will remain profitable.
Data and research-design risk
Results can be distorted by missing or incorrect observations, timestamp errors, corporate-action handling, symbol changes, stale quotes, bad depth reconstruction, survivorship bias, lookahead bias, universe selection, or unrepresentative coverage. A provider's right to display data does not automatically grant every research or redistribution right.
Reproducibility also depends on the exact dataset version, preprocessing, assumptions, software version, seeds, parameters, and evaluation path. A result that cannot be reproduced should not be treated as reliable merely because it looks plausible.
Models, signals, optimization, and AI
Every model and signal simplifies the market. It may omit material variables, encode unstable relationships, or behave differently after a regime change. Parameter searches and optimizers can select noise, especially when many alternatives are tried and only favorable results are retained.
AI output can be incorrect, incomplete, insecure, or fabricated. Generated code, explanations, research ideas, and diagnoses require human review and independent validation. Simulation fidelity
Vector, bar, trade, quote, and supported depth simulations answer different questions and use different assumptions. Faster evaluation can support broad exploration without reproducing the ordering, queue, liquidity, or timing behavior available to a more detailed event simulation.
Access to the complete fidelity range supported by Arizmic does not mean every dataset contains trades, quotes, or market depth, or that every strategy can be evaluated at every fidelity. The selected data and evaluator determine what can actually be modeled.
Execution and market risk
Modeled fills may differ materially from executable fills. Queue position, spread, liquidity, latency, slippage, fees, partial fills, rejects, market impact, halts, auctions, order types, and broker rules can change an outcome. A simulation cannot guarantee that an order would have been accepted or filled at the modeled time or price.
Markets can move rapidly and losses can exceed historical estimates or expectations. Leverage, derivatives, short positions, concentration, and gaps can increase losses and, in some circumstances, create obligations beyond the initial capital allocated.
Provider, broker, and operational risk
Data, AI, broker, network, operating-system, and hardware services can be delayed, unavailable, inconsistent, compromised, or changed without notice. Credentials can expire or be revoked. Broker and local state can diverge, and reconciliation may require operator intervention.
A supported connection is not a guarantee that every account, instrument, order type, market, or jurisdiction is available. Users must review the exact provider support matrix, entitlements, account permissions, and release status.
